Why Do Companies Engage in Horizontal Direct Investment?
There are several reasons why companies might pursue HDI:
Market Expansion: Companies can enter new markets and reach new customers without having to start from scratch. Economies of Scale: By replicating their successful domestic operations abroad, firms can achieve economies of scale and reduce costs. Brand Recognition: Leveraging a well-known brand can facilitate smoother entry into foreign markets. Competitive Advantage: By entering new markets, firms can preempt competitors and secure a stronger market position.
